Output 3588d5869f4c5ced9b28879e09ec64db8671d2830fbedd76e95871bc4e0eab6b:5

value
128064
script pubkey
OP_0 OP_PUSHBYTES_20 f5049004910d7cd618531da30d9974253a968326
address
bc1q75zfqpy3p47dvxznrk3smxt5y5afdqexkn7nc3
transaction
3588d5869f4c5ced9b28879e09ec64db8671d2830fbedd76e95871bc4e0eab6b
spent
true